How Many Valence Electrons Does Vanadium Have?

The electron configuration for vanadium is 1s22s22p63s23p64s23d3. To determine the number of valence electrons, we look at the outermost shell, which is the 4s orbital and the 3d orbital.

In the case of vanadium, the 4s orbital has 2 electrons, and the 3d orbital has 3 electrons. Therefore, vanadium has a total of 5 valence electrons.
